tim armstrong Posted August 16, 2009 Share Posted August 16, 2009 I've had this happen in the past. Be sure to check in detail the account details you provided. ie if you gave your name spelt with first name and second initial - John R. Jones but your account uses your full name - John Robert Jones, their system may reject the transfer. Regards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
